Having a dog requires a lot of time, energy, and attention-- all of which they should get on a consistent daily basis. However, have you experienced a time when you just needed your dog to settle down?

Whether it's leaving for work, arriving home, or hosting visitors, a hyper, jumpy dog is not the most ideal best friend. 

Join us at our new workshop focused on settling your dog through rewards-based training and enrichment activities.
